For the security review of Quillgate's quota layer: each tenant gets a base quota from the Pebbleworth tier table, with burst credits decaying hourly. Overrides are audited and expire after thirty days; nothing is permanent by design. Watch for the shared-tenant edge case where sub-accounts inherit the parent ceiling — that's the most likely abuse vector. Enforcement happens at the gateway, not in the services, so bypass attempts show up in gateway logs. The complete quota schema and audit procedure are documented on the internal review page.

dashboard of yahaf-kajep = https://jira.zemvarsys.internal/display/projects/browse/browse/a08b

Finance Review — Brightlace Reseller Programme. Quick summary for the team: the Brightlace reseller programme closed its first full quarter at 312k net, about 8% over plan. Margins held at 24% despite the Keldon Bay promo, which is better than we feared. Two resellers are behind on settlement — nothing alarming yet, but flagging for the aged-debt review. Tier-two onboarding costs came in high; worth trimming the welcome kit. Overall, the programme is earning its keep. How it fits the bigger picture is noted below.

confidential, kagup-bafog: Fraaxax Group is in early talks to buy Soroxox Group for about $343.8 million. The Olidor launch date is June 14, and nothing goes to the press before then. Legal wants the Aldmirek Logistics term sheet signed before July 23.

Changed defaults in Splitfork, our assignment service. Bucketing now uses sticky hashing per account instead of per session, and the holdout slice grew from 2% to 5%. Callers relying on session-level reassignment must opt in explicitly. Review the diff against the new baseline; the updated default configuration is listed below.

config for tagep-kajof:
[casir]
port = 6379
region = south-1
host = casir.paliqdyn.example
team = tamax
timeout_ms = 250
retries = 2